The summit will feature plenary sessions, panel discussions, poster displays, and networking opportunities for speakers, delegates and sponsors. Opportunities for trainees and early career investigators. Trainees can showcase their work and enhance their presentation skills through mini research rounds. These mini-rounds are one-hour webinars open to members of the network and the public to raise the profile of early career investigators, exposing their work to feedback and potential collaboration and career advancement.

New Investigator Award This award provides salary support to individuals who have clearly demonstrated excellence during their doctoral and post-doctoral training in cardiovascular or cerebrovascular research.
